Wagering Requirements Explained in Depth

Wagering requirements translate the headline bonus amount into the real volume of betting you must complete. At Vodds, these rules apply both to sports trading bonuses and to the casino section, and they have a huge impact on whether a promotion genuinely fits your style of play and bankroll.

In the casino, wagering is usually expressed as a multiple of the bonus, or the bonus plus deposit. For example, a £100 casino bonus with a 35x requirement means you must wager £3,500 on qualifying games. Slots typically contribute 100% to this total, while table games and live casino contribute far less, reflecting their lower house edge and the fact that serious players can grind these games very close to break-even.

🎮 Game Category📊 Wagering Contribution💰 Example Calculation⚡ Best Strategy⚠️ Restrictions
Slots (All)100%£10 bet = £10 wageringFocus on high RTP slotsMaximum bet often around £5 per spin when using bonus funds
Table Games10%£10 bet = £1 wageringUse low house-edge games sparinglySome variants may be excluded from bonus play
Live Casino10%£10 bet = £1 wageringBlackjack or baccarat with sensible stakesSystem betting and certain patterns may be restricted
Video Poker5%£10 bet = £0.50 wageringGood for low-variance sessionsLimited game selection may qualify
Jackpot Slots0%£10 bet = £0 wageringPlay only for fun, not for clearing bonusesOften contribute nothing to wagering

For UK players, the percentages are what matter. If a slot contributes 100%, a £10 spin adds £10 to your wagering total. If a live roulette game contributes 10%, a £10 stake adds only £1, making it far less efficient for clearing requirements, even if you prefer the pace of live games. This is why many punters use slots to work through casino wagering and treat table games as a separate leisure activity rather than a tool for grinding through rollover.

Sports trading bonuses at Vodds work differently. From the offers I've seen, Vodds has typically run a 25% deposit bonus up to around £1,000 with wagering somewhere between 5x and 10x on deposit plus bonus. So if you put in £1,000 and get £250 extra, expect to turn over something in the region of the low five figures before you can cash it out, rather than a quick in-and-out session. Terms usually exclude ultra-sharp books, require minimum odds (for example, over 1.50), and may bar certain markets such as obvious "draw cover" strategies.

On paper, the maths only really works in your favour if you're already breaking even or winning before the bonus kicks in - which most casual punters, me included, can't honestly claim every month. A recreational bettor losing around 5% of turnover would expect to lose about £625 over £12,500 in bets, which already exceeds the £250 bonus. You'll hear the same message from serious analysts and safer-gambling campaigns: a bonus doesn't change the maths in your favour, it just changes how bumpy the ride feels.

Important Bonus Restrictions and Excluded Games

Restrictions attached to Vodds bonuses can be every bit as important as the main wagering figure. UK players who skim past small clauses about markets, games, or stake sizes risk losing bonus balances or seeing withdrawals delayed while the operator reviews account activity. Taking five minutes to read the details is far cheaper than losing a chunk of winnings over a technicality.

Sports bonuses at Vodds include specific limitations on which markets qualify. Analysis of typical terms shows that bets on "Draw" outcomes or both sides of the same event may not count towards wagering. Combined positions that lock in near-certain profit inside the Vodds ecosystem can trigger "bonus abuse" flags, potentially leading to removal of bonus funds, although your core deposits are usually protected unless fraud is suspected.

Casino promotions also carry exclusions. Progressive jackpot slots often contribute 0% to wagering, while certain high-RTP table and live games have reduced contribution rates or are entirely barred from bonus play. You'll see similar rules at other Curaçao-licensed sites too. Industry bodies such as the European Gaming and Betting Association have flagged that promos on low-margin games need tighter limits, or the sums just don't add up for the operator in the long run.

  • Non-sticky bonuses keep your deposit separate; you usually play with real money first and can often withdraw it if you have not touched the bonus balance. Sticky bonuses merge deposit and bonus into one pot, and the bonus portion cannot be withdrawn directly, only any winnings that remain after wagering. Always check which structure applies at Vodds and remember that both models involve risk, because bets and casino games are entertainment products with a built-in house edge, not reliable investments or a salary replacement.
